A land acquisition analyst is a professional responsible for researching, analyzing, and acquiring land for various purposes. They work with real estate developers, government agencies, and corporations to identify potential land parcels for purchase or development. Their primary role involves conducting extensive market research, evaluating property values, and assessing potential risks and opportunities associated with land acquisition projects.
Land acquisition analysts also negotiate with landowners and other stakeholders to secure the best possible deals. They collaborate with legal teams to review contracts, zoning regulations, and environmental impact assessments. Additionally, they may assist in obtaining necessary permits and approvals for land development projects.

Land Acquisition Analyst salary in Sweden
Average Yearly Salary of Land Acquisition Analyst in Sweden is approximately 884,419 SEK (80,210 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Sweden is a Scandinavian country located in Northern Europe. With a population of about 10 million people, it is known for its high standard of living and social welfare system. The country covers an area of approximately 450,000 square kilometers, making it the third-largest country in the European Union.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 619,985 SEK (62,990 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Land Acquisition Analyst job salary compared to average salary in Sweden.
Comparison shows that a person working as Land Acquisition Analyst in Sweden earns on average:
1.43 times the average salary (or 143% of average salary).
